Default Starter grinding with 4l80e install

Car had a th350 with dished flexplate in it for the past year while i was saving up to get my 4l80e rebuilt. Well I just got the 80e in over the past weekend between two snow storms and now i'm getting issues with the starter and flexplate grinding. Had no issues with the dished flexplate that was in the car before but i'm thinking maybe the 80e flexplate in the car is out of round or something? In the first video you can see it'll get to a point where the bendix won't even be able to turn the flexplate as it gets stuck behind it. Is there a difference between a 5.3 and 6.0 starter as far as bendix placement for the different flex plates? It doesn't make any sounds when the car is running so the flexplate isn't rubbing against the bellhousing or anything like that. So excited to finally have overdrive and now this happens i think the videos are having issues but you can still here it

What FW/spacer setup did you use. I see the FW look wobbly, did the converter pull out to the FW or did you try and draw it against it. They list diff starters, but as far as I know the FW's are the same dia. I have had to shim starters, but the stock ones usually don't need it. If your converter bottomed out against the crank before the pads touched the FW then you have a problem. GM didn't do us any favors on the FW side, lol.

This is a stock 6.0 flexplate with stock 6.0 spacer where the spacer goes on before the flexplate. And there was about a gap between the converter and flexplate, don't remember how big the gap was but I used the converter bolts to pull the converter in the last 3/16" because it was a little tight (assuming from the centering sleeve from the spacer to converter?).
The converter is a new rebuilt unit so I was going to purchase new starter bolts and a new flexplate for now since those are both the oldest components?
Come to think of it the converter is painted, should i sand off the paint on the snout so it'll slide into the spacer easier?

You shouldn't have to pull the converter onto the FW, if something is stopping it from registering, if can pull the FW out of shape. Hopefully they didn't use the 60E snout on the converter intended for the curved FW and no spacer. If you ran a straight edge on the snout, and meas. to the pads, you get aprx. 1/4", that would be a short snout. Rem the bolts and see if you get space bet the FW pads and conv.

Took the torque converter bolts out and pushed converter back and had 1/8" gap between converter and flexplate pads which is normal right? Was also able to slide converter to flexplate without needing to use the bolts. I measured the gap on each side of the flexplate between the flexplate and bellhousing and also had about 1/8" until i rotated the engine and at some points couldn't get the drill bit in the gap so I think the issue is an out of round flexplate or spacer or something isn't lined up. I have a new flexplate and spacer coming in tomorrow and I will install them on Sunday and update this thread
